Bartlesville Citizens Urge Support for G.O. Bonds and Sales Tax Extension
Residents Bob Fraser and Laura Jensen appear on local radio show to advocate for upcoming ballot measures.
Published on Feb. 4, 2026
Got story updates? Submit your updates here. ›
Bartlesville citizens Bob Fraser and Laura Jensen appeared on KWON Radio's COMMUNITY CONNECTION program to encourage voters to support the City of Bartlesville's upcoming general obligation (G.O.) bond and sales tax extension measures on the February 10th ballot.
Why it matters
The G.O. bonds and sales tax extension are critical for funding infrastructure improvements and maintaining essential city services in Bartlesville. Voter approval of these ballot measures will help ensure the community's long-term economic and civic vitality.
The details
During the radio appearance, Bob Fraser and Laura Jensen voiced their support for the upcoming votes, urging Bartlesville residents to approve the G.O. bonds and sales tax extension. Fraser stated, "We keep saying over and over and over, there's a need for these bonds and this sales tax extension to keep our city moving forward."
- The City of Bartlesville G.O. bond and sales tax extension election will be held on February 10, 2026.
